The Swedish company IKEA is a furniture retail store famous for its affordable home furnishings. The blue-and yellow logo is easily recognized throughout its stores. IKEA products usually combine traditional styles with modern elements. The Poang armchair, for example, has a layered and glued bentwood frame that's available in different finishes. The Lack series of coffee and side tables as well as the Billy bookcases are also very popular. IKEA also pays more focus on sustainability by removing PVC, and reducing formaldehyde levels lacquers and glues. The company has also begun using other materials, like recycled wood.
IKEA also has a range of kitchen appliances and accessories. The company has its own design team that is responsible for developing products that reflect the Swedish heritage of the company. The founder of IKEA, Ingvar Kamprad, was a renowned entrepreneur who started the business as a pen and pencil salesman at the age of 17.
IKEA furniture is available in pre-assembled forms. This reduces the cost of shipping and waste from packaging. IKEA can also offer more furniture at a lower cost. IKEA, in addition to its design team, has partnered with companies like Universal and Disney to develop video games and other products.
IKEA, despite its popularity it has been attacked by some for its non-sustainable business practices and the use of raw materials sourced from protected forests. The company was also accused of destabilizing small businesses and destabilizing communities. Nevertheless, IKEA has remained committed to its goal of democratizing access and quality design and assisting people in living better lives at home.

The Lovesac Company, an American furniture retailer, is known for a modular system that is patent-pending of furniture called Sactionals. It also sells Sacs bags, which are seats filled with a unique foam mixture. Lovesac's founder, Shawn Nelson, created the first Lovesac when he was just 18 years old in his parents' basement. Since then, the brand has expanded to include more than 76 stores across the United States.

A sectional couch offers the flexibility and space needed to entertain large groups. These pieces of furniture come in a variety of styles and fabrics. You can pick a basic set such as an armchair with three or two seats, and an ottoman, or an expansive configuration that includes reclining seats and chaises. If you want to take comfort to the next level, you should consider a power sectional that comes with power recline features and adjustable headrests.
Modular sectional couches are ideal for those who rent and are frequent hosts as they can be rearranged to meet the needs of each room. They can also be disassembled into fewer pieces, making them easier to fit through narrow elevators and staircases. When you are choosing a modular sofa, search for one with kiln-dried wooden frames and durable foam or metal springs. Select an upholstery fabric that is suitable for your lifestyle, such as an anti-stain performance fabric for families with children and pets.

As a direct to consumer brand, Floyd aims to create stylish and durable furniture that fits into contemporary lifestyles. Their sofas are built to stand up to wear and tear while being easy to assemble. The instructions are clear and easy to follow and so is the Floyd Tool (which also doubles as an heavy-duty bottle-opener). Sink Down Sectional is the company's latest product and their most comfortable sofa. It's custom-made to order in a variety fabric colors and configurations and comes with large cushions, a luxurious back, and even a customizable ottoman.
The original Floyd's sofa, The Sofa is minimalist in style and comes in either two or three seats. The wood base is available in light birch and darker walnut. It can also be covered in a fabric to match cushions. The Sofa is available in sofa couch for sale six upholstery choices, including a vibrant yellow and a lovely light green.
For durability, they use fabrics designed with stain and fade resistance in mind. The company has partnered with Kvadrat, a Danish textile company to develop two of its own fabrics, Sisu and Tonus. Sisu is a check fabric with a variegated weave, while Tonus is a classic wool fabric in a bold color palette.
It would be nice if these fabrics had a double rub count, if you were concerned about their durability. They also don't have a dedicated fabric page to showcase the different options available, which can be a bit frustrating.
Floyd offers free swatches, so you can see how the fabric looks in your home. This is a good method to view the fabric in your own home and get a sense of the texture and weight.
